Two-way texting

Text customers about their own repair, from a number that belongs to your shop, with their replies landing in one place.

From your shop, not a shared number

Your shop gets its own local number, registered with the mobile carriers in your business name. Messages go out saying who they are from, and replies come back into the message centre against the customer and the job.

US carriers require the business behind every text to be registered before anything can send. RVDesk collects what the registration needs and files it for you, and the status is on your Integrations screen the whole way through.

Consent is collected the way a shop actually works — verbally at the counter when the customer gives you their number — and what they are told is published on a page of your own so it can be verified.

Frequently asked

Why can I not text straight away?
US carriers require the business behind the messages to be registered first. It is not a setting we can switch on — the registration has to clear.
What do I need to provide?
Your legal business name, business type, address, a named contact, and either an EIN or, if you are a sole proprietor without one, a mobile number to verify by text.
How do customers opt in?
They give you their number and you tell them what they will receive. The disclosure is published on your own consent page so it can be verified.
How do they stop?
They reply STOP. It is honoured automatically and the shop cannot text them again by mistake.
